コード例 #1
0
ファイル: relaxation.py プロジェクト: IcyVein/FDTD
def F_gauss_sine(t):
     dt = 10.0
     omega = 1.5
     return A*exp(-(t-40)**2/dt**2)*sin(t*omega)
コード例 #2
0
ファイル: relaxation.py プロジェクト: IcyVein/FDTD
def F_sine(t):
     omega = 7.0e-1
     return A*sin(t*omega)
コード例 #3
0
def F_gauss_sine(t):
    dt = 10.0
    omega = 1.5
    return A * exp(-(t - 40)**2 / dt**2) * sin(t * omega)
コード例 #4
0
def F_sine(t):
    omega = 7.0e-1
    return A * sin(t * omega)
コード例 #5
0
ファイル: assignment7_3.py プロジェクト: pandaops/EL2100
import scipy
import matplotlib.pyplot as graph
import math
import scipy.special as sp

samples=scipy.linspace(0,5,num=101)
results=scipy.linspace(0,0,num=101)

# Vector assignment
results = sp.sin(samples*samples)

# Plotting the graph
graph.plot(samples,results,'ro',samples,results,'k')
graph.show()
コード例 #6
0
ファイル: assignment7_4.py プロジェクト: pandaops/EL2100
import scipy
import matplotlib.pyplot as graph
import math
import scipy.special as sp

samples=scipy.linspace(-3,+3,101)
results=scipy.linspace(0,0,101)

# Vector operation for each k
for k in range(1,11,2):
    results += sp.sin(k*samples)/k

# Graph plotting
graph.plot(samples,results,'ro',samples,results,'k')
graph.show()